Job summary

A Singapore-based recruitment firm is seeking a skilled individual to provide administrative support to senior executives. Responsibilities include managing schedules, handling confidential information, preparing reports, and acting as a liaison between executives and stakeholders. The ideal candidate will have a diploma, exceptional organizational skills, and proficiency in Microsoft Office. This role requires discretion and professionalism and offers an opportunity to support executives in a dynamic environment.

Qualifications

  • Minimum Diploma and above.
  • Exceptional organizational and time management sk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office tools and calendar management software.
  • Discretion and professionalism in handling confidential information.

Responsibilities

  • Provide high-level administrative support to senior executives.
  • Manage calendars, schedules, and travel arrangements efficiently.
  • Handle confidential information with discretion and professionalism.
  • Prepare and edit documents, reports, and presentations.
  • Act as a liaison between executives and internal/external stakeholders.
  • Organize meetings and events, ensuring all logistics are in place.
  • Anticipate the needs of executives and proactively address them.
  • Maintain an organized filing system for easy access to important documents.
  • Assist in managing projects and tracking progress.
  • Build a strong working relationship with executives and contribute to their success.
